As promised, I have compared your scatterfile with the one I got from analyzing the EMMC_BOOT_1 and EMMS_USER areas with WwR.
Surprisingly I have found a difference between the two, which may be significant:
Yours gives:
partition_size: 0x100000
and mine:
partition_size: 0x40000
for the preloader partition.
I think mine is correct (Edit: Spoiler: I was wrong about this!), because when I have SP Flash Tool (latest version) connected to the Cosmo, it gives:
Boot 1 Size: 0x40000
Boot 2 Size: 0x40000
RPMB Size: 0x1000000
GP(1-4) Size: 0x0
UA Size: 0x1d1f000000
Actually that last number is the coveted size for the full EMMS_USER dump with WwR, so it appears there are easier ways if you just want to get just that number than running WwR.

However, WwR has proved invaluable to get that scatter file. I've come across some other tools to analyze the partial dumps via google, but didn't really take a closer look, because SP Flash Tool only works on windows for me, and for CLI/programming stuff I strongly prefer Linux.
I now have the full readback of the cosmo, done with SP Flash tool and I'm going to just root it. I'll see if I can recover the userdata.img afterwards, but I doubt it which is why I just updated all the app backups I could round up.
(Final thought: There's a reserved partition called OTP, which apparently cannot be read back with SP flash tool. OTP refers to "One Time Pad" in cryptographic terms. I didn't check the android developer documentation on that so this is just a guess, but if that partition is used as a one-time-pad for encrypting userdata and it is reset while unlocking the bootloader, there's not a chance in hell you could use the encrypted userdata.img dumped with the previous OTP. Hm... Maybe I should try to read back the reserved partitions by putting in the numbers. I'm going to try that now, before resetting. But maybe the data will be incompatible for other reasons.)
